Artwork story

Hospitality: A call to open one's home and heart to those who are unfamiliar or from different backgrounds. Empathy and Compassion: A reminder to see past differences and recognize the shared humanity in all people, especially those in need or who are marginalized. Transcendence of Prejudice: Encouragement to rise above "us versus them" mentalities, cultural animosities, and personal prejudices. Spiritual or Moral Duty: In a Christian context, it directly references the biblical verse Matthew 25:35: "I was a stranger and you welcomed me," implying that welcoming others is a divine

This beautiful piece titled "a stranger welcomed" is about two friends who immigrated to Lagos in search of a better life,was executed on pastel on paper with systematic detail, this concept was done from a references of a photograph taken by me of this two friends about board a taxi, central Lagos motor park by Lagos Cathedral.
